导读 在编程的世界里,GUI(图形用户界面)的设计是一门艺术,而JFrame作为Java中构建窗口的基础类,其布局管理器则是实现美观与功能兼具界面的...
在编程的世界里,GUI(图形用户界面)的设计是一门艺术,而JFrame作为Java中构建窗口的基础类,其布局管理器则是实现美观与功能兼具界面的关键所在。今天,让我们一起探索几种常见的JFrame布局方式吧!🌟
首先,我们来聊聊FlowLayout(流布局)。这是一种最简单的布局管理器,它会像文字一样从左到右排列组件,当一行放不下时,自动换行。就像是往一个容器里随意丢东西,东西满了就往下一层放,简单又直观。💡
接下来是BorderLayout(边框布局),这种布局将窗口分为五个区域:东、南、西、北和中心。每个区域只能放置一个组件,非常适合需要明确区分主次内容的应用场景。就好比你在家里布置家具,沙发放在中央,电视挂在墙上,茶几摆在前面,各司其职井然有序。🛋️📺
最后不得不提的是GridLayout(网格布局),它会把窗口分成固定大小的网格,并且每个网格可以容纳一个组件。如果你想要一个整齐划一的效果,比如计算器那样的按钮排布,那它就是你的最佳选择啦!🔢
通过以上三种基本布局的学习,相信你已经对如何让程序界面更加友好有了更深的理解。继续加油,未来还有更多有趣的知识等着你去发现哦!🚀